Travelling to Thailand from U.S. June 2014-Flight question

Hey there!

My friend and I are traveling from the States this mid-June to Thailand.

I understand this is not necessarily 'high season' in Thailand and I am wondering how far in advance I should consider booking planes tickets? What I should consider a good price? Right now the tickets that would accommodate our travel dates are starting around $1650 and upwards. Should I consider this as a deal, or shall I wait until the date gets a little closer, or am I running the risk of prices going up even more?

I appreciate any advice you got!

Thanks!
